Official documentation of land and building ownership within Bossier Parish, Louisiana, constitutes the core of this data set. These documents typically include deeds, mortgages, liens, assessments, and other relevant transaction details. A hypothetical example might be the record of a property transfer from one owner to another, detailing the sale price, date, and legal description of the land.
Access to this information offers significant advantages for various stakeholders. Title companies rely on these records to ensure clear ownership and facilitate smooth real estate transactions. Potential buyers can research property history, assess market value, and make informed purchasing decisions. Government agencies utilize the data for tax assessment, urban planning, and infrastructure development. Historical researchers can glean insights into community development and land ownership patterns over time. Public availability promotes transparency and accountability within the local real estate market.
